Final Fantasy Dissidia Details


Dissida: Final Fantasy
Some scans have been released for Final Fantasy Dissidia, the Final Fantasy game headed for the PSP. In a bit of a shocking twist, the game appears to be a 3D brawler, now there's not much to go on other than the scan from Jump Magazine, but it does definitely have the looks of a brawler.

The game shot seems to have two pictures of two seperate fights, one involving what appears to be Cecil and Golbez, and the next featuring Zidane and Kuja. On second glance the first two might actually be Garland vs The Emperor from FF1 and FF2 respectively. I can't be certain.

Source: Jump Magazine scan
